Standards
ABB strongly supports the drive to harmonise European standards and actively
contributes to various working groups within both IEC and CENELEC.
IEC defines:
Electrical:

IEC 60034-1: Rating and performance
 IEC 60034-2: Methods for determining losses and efficiency of rotating
electrical machinery from tests
 IEC 60034-8: Terminal markings and direction of rotation of rotating
machines
 IEC 60034-12: Starting performance of single-speed three-phase cage
induction motors for voltages up to and including 660V

Standards
Mechanical:
IEC 60072-1: Dimensions and output series for rotating electrical
machines - Part1: Frame numbers 56 to 400 and flange numbers 55 to
1080
IEC 60072-2: Dimensions and output series for rotating electrical
machines - Part2: Frame numbers 355 to 1000 and flange numbers
1180 to 2360
IEC 60034-5: Degrees of protection provided by the integral design of
rotating electrical machines (IP code) - Classifications
IEC 60034-6: Methods of cooling
IEC 60034-7: Classification of types of construction, mounting
arrangements and terminal box position (IM code)
IEC 60034-9: Noise limits
IEC 60034-14: Mechanical vibration of certain machines with shaft
heights 56mm and higher - Measurement, evaluation and limits of
vibration

Permissible temperature rise of marine motors
Classification Ambient Permissible temperature
societies and rise K for stator windings
standards temperature Insulation class
°C B F
IEC Publ. 34-1 40 80 105
IEC 92-301 50 70 90
ABS 50 70 90
BV 50 70 90
CCS 50 70 90
CR 45 75 95
DNV 45 70 90
GL 45 75 95
KR 50 70 90
LR 45 70 90
NK 45 75 95
RINA 50 70 90
RS 45 80 100

Vibration IEC 60034-14:1996
Maximum vibration velocity in mm/s,
for the shaft height 56-400mm
VibrationSpeed56-132160-225250-400
grade r/minmm/s mm/s mm/s
N (Normal)600 to 3600 1.8 2.8 3.5
R (Reduced) 600 to 1800 0.71 1.12 1.8
>1800 to 36001.12 1.8 2.8
S (Special)600 to 1800 0.45 0.71 1.12
>1800 to 36000.71 1.12 1.8
